Cage 开源项目教程
cageA Wayland kiosk项目地址:https://gitcode.com/gh_mirrors/ca/cage
项目介绍
Cage 是一个由 cage-kiosk 维护的开源项目,旨在提供一套灵活且强大的解决方案,以构建互动式亭台(Kiosk)应用界面。该项目专注于为触摸交互场景优化用户体验,支持多种平台部署,广泛应用于自助服务终端、展览展示、公共信息服务等场景。Cage 结合了前端技术的最新进展,通过简洁的API设计,使得开发者能够快速搭建稳定的亭台应用。
项目快速启动
要快速启动 Cage 项目,首先确保你的开发环境已经安装了 Node.js 和 Git。以下是基本步骤:
安装依赖
-
克隆项目:
git clone https://github.com/cage-kiosk/cage.git
-
进入项目目录:
cd cage
-
安装依赖:
npm install 或 yarn
运行示例应用
项目中通常包含一个示例应用,用于快速体验其功能。运行以下命令启动应用:
npm run dev 或 yarn dev
这将启动一个本地服务器,你可以通过浏览器访问 http://localhost:3000
来查看并交互于Cage框架提供的基本应用界面。
应用案例和最佳实践
Cage 在多个实际应用场景中展示了其能力,包括但不限于自助点餐系统、博物馆导览终端、酒店自助服务站等。最佳实践中,开发者应当遵循以下原则:
- 响应式设计:确保应用在不同尺寸的设备上均能良好显示。
- 触摸优先:设计时优先考虑触控操作的友好性,比如增大点击区域、简化交互流程。
- 性能优化:利用Cage提供的缓存机制和异步加载策略来提升页面加载速度和流畅度。
典型生态项目
Cage的生态系统还在不断扩展中,典型的生态项目可能涵盖特定行业解决方案的插件、主题模板或集成其他技术栈的桥梁库。例如,可以开发专门适用于零售业的支付接口插件,或是面向教育领域的互动教学模板。尽管具体实例可能需从社区获取最新信息,但Cage的设计鼓励贡献者创建易于集成的模块,以丰富其生态系统。
此教程为基础框架,实际使用过程中,建议深入阅读项目文档和参与社区讨论,以便更全面地掌握Cage的强大功能。
cageA Wayland kiosk项目地址:https://gitcode.com/gh_mirrors/ca/cage
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考